An extraordinary archival piece from Julien Macdonald’s era at Givenchy, dating to Fall/Winter 2004
This garment exists as a one-of-one sample prototype, embodying the theatrical glamour and sculptural excess that defined Macdonald’s vision for the house during the early 2000s
Constructed in a luminous floral jacquard satin with a muted smoky lavender tone, the dress transforms couture bow construction into wearable architecture
The silhouette appears restrained from the front with its elegant bateau neckline and softly cocooned shape, before unfolding dramatically at the back into an oversized sculptural bow with elongated trailing ribbons cascading nearly to the floor
The exaggerated rear volume creates an almost surreal profile, balancing softness and monumentality in a way that feels unmistakably couture
The gathered bubble hem further amplifies the sculptural effect, giving the piece movement and dimensionality from every angle
